Kazakhstan GDP grew 6.5% in 2025 to 159.6 trillion tenge

Kazakhstan's gross domestic product reached 159.6 trillion tenge in 2025, growing 6.5% in real terms from the previous year, the Bureau of National Statistics reported. Transport and warehousing led sector growth at 19.4%, followed by construction at 17.5%. Turkistan region posted the highest regional growth at 13%.

Sector Performance

The Bureau of National Statistics reported that transport and warehousing expanded 19.4% in real terms in 2025. Construction output rose 17.5%, while trade increased 8.1%. Industry grew 7.7% and information and communication services added 6.4%.

Regional Distribution

Turkistan region recorded the fastest growth in gross regional product at 13%. North Kazakhstan region followed with 11.6% growth, and Astana city grew 10.2%. Almaty city accounted for 22.7% of national GDP, Astana for 12.3%, and Atyrau region for 10.4%. GDP per capita averaged 7,827.2 thousand tenge, equivalent to 15,006.4 US dollars. Atyrau region led per capita GDP at 23,332 thousand tenge, followed by Almaty city at 15,601.1 thousand tenge and Ulytau region at 13,831.8 thousand tenge.

Unobserved Economy

The share of the unobserved economy in GDP fell to 15.69% in 2025, down 1.02 percentage points from the previous year. Ulytau region recorded the largest decline in the unobserved economy share at 5.78 percentage points. Abai region saw a reduction of 4.43 percentage points, and Atyrau region decreased by 3.92 percentage points.
